- It sounds simple, but 2 wires can be a challenge to troubleshoot sometimes. This video covers techniques to efficiently trouble shoot aircraft wiring. Don't work on airplanes? Don't worry, this information can also be used in other wiring situations.

Can you make more videos troubleshooting aircraft wires with a megger
Since I worked on brand new aircraft, I had very little reason to use a Megger during trouble shooting. The wire insulation was new, so high impedance shorts were very rare. Very sorry about that.
